Rotary Club of Ikeja Township celebrates charter presentation in style

District 9112 Governor urges new Rotarians to work together for growth and sustainability

Rotary Club of Ikeja Township charter marks a new chapter as District 9112 leaders urge teamwork, service, and sustainability among new members

Rotary Club of Ikeja Township charter was officially celebrated in grand style on Thursday, 30 November 2025, at the Rotary District 9112 office in Lagos, marking the birth of a new chapter in service and fellowship.

The well-attended Charter Presentation and induction ceremony drew leading Rotarians and guests from across the district, including the District Governor, Rotarian Lanre Adedoyin, who urged the new club to embrace hard work and unity.

“The real work of being a true Rotarian begins after the charter,” he said. “It takes commitment to keep a club afloat during its early years, so I implore you to roll up your sleeves and stay focused.”

Adding his voice, Public Relations strategist and Chairman of the District Public Image Committee, Past Assistant Governor (PAG) Ehi Braimah, emphasised the importance of love, understanding, and collaboration as the foundation of a thriving Rotary club.

Distinguished Rotarians, including the United President of the Rotary Club of Ikeja Alausa Central, PAG Olalekan Fadairo of Rotary Club of Ikorodu Metro, and members of the District Governor’s team, graced the event in solidarity.

In her acceptance speech, the Charter President, Rotarian Ambassador Ariyike Olukayode Elegbede, pledged to uphold the ideals of Rotary while leading the new club towards impactful service.

“We will not relent in our commitment to humanity and the continuous growth of our club,” she affirmed.

The newly inducted executives include Rotarian Victor Ojelabi as Vice President and President-Elect, Rotarian Akinfenwa Monsuroh Anike as Secretary, Rotarian Moyosore Ojelabi as Treasurer, and Rotarian Veronica Omoniyi as Club Administration and WeCare Chairman.

Others are Rotarian Adewale Onifade, Membership Chairman; Rotarian Mahona Ahide, Public Image Chairman; Rotarian Prince Adeniyi Akinola Olaige, Rotary Foundation Chairman; Rotarian Jeremiah Agada, Service Project Chairman; Rotarian Olamide Olayinka, Sergeant-at-Arms; Rotarian Babatunde Afolabi, Youth Service Chairman; and Rotarian Olayinka Dixon, International Service Chairman.

The ceremony symbolised the Rotary Club of Ikeja Township charter as a powerful step in expanding Rotary’s reach in Lagos and reaffirming its mission of service above self.
